Laser Toning
What should I expect after my laser treatment?
The area will turn red immediately following your treatment and last several hours. It is possible that you may experience several blisters, scaling or crusting following the procedure. If the treated area is near the upper cheek or eye area, you should anticipate some swelling. If this occurs, sleep with your head elevated and apply ice packs.
What should I do if the treated area begins to crust or blister?
The skin should be treated gently twice daily with applications of Polysporin or bacitracin ointment. If the area has increased redness and itching, discontinue the ointment and call the office. It is not necessary to wear a bandage. However if a bandage is preferred, a telfa (non-stick) bandage should be used, It can be cut to size and secured with paper tape. The area may get wet while bathing, but swimming should be avoided for 1 week following the laser toning treatment.
May I wear make-up following the treatment?
Make-up may be worn if there is no blistering or crusting following the treatment. Particular care must be taken to avoid irritation of the skin while removing make-up. You should avoid abrasive or irritating make-up removers.
May I be exposed to the sun following the laser toning procedure?
Direct exposure to sunlight should be avoided following your laser toning procedure. If there is no crusting or blistering, a sunscreen of SPF-30 or higher should be applied to the treated area for 2 months following the treatment to avoid sun damage.
When should I return to have my treatment area re-evaluated?
